Upcoming Innovation: Personalized Weather Control?
The idea of personal weather adjustment once felt like pure fiction, but advances in climate engineering are sparking serious discussion. Picture a time where localized rainfall enhances agricultural yields, or precise chill alleviates metropolitan heat islands. While obstacles regarding societal implications and likely unintended effects remain considerable, present research into atmosphere manipulation and environmental methods indicate that contained climate influence might evolve a possibility sooner than we expect.

The Earth Devoid of the Satellite
Imagine a world where Earth spins without its silvery companion. Tides would be dramatically altered, eliminating the predictable rise and fall that influences coastal habitats. The rotational angle of Earth would likely experience more instability over extended timescales, leading to dramatic climatic changes and conceivably rendering certain regions uninhabitable for organisms. Solar cycles might be slightly shorter, and the absence of the Moon's influence would also affect the Earth’s internal processes , maybe inducing frequent volcanic eruptions and rearranging the Earth’s outer layer. To summarize, Earth without the Moon would be an fundamentally transformed world.
